Searched refs:CursorKind (Results 1 - 14 of 14) sorted by relevance

/netbsd-current/external/apache2/llvm/dist/clang/bindings/python/tests/cindex/
H A Dtest_cursor_kind.py6 from clang.cindex import CursorKind namespace
13 self.assertEqual(CursorKind.UNEXPOSED_DECL.name, 'UNEXPOSED_DECL')
16 kinds = CursorKind.get_all_kinds()
17 self.assertIn(CursorKind.UNEXPOSED_DECL, kinds)
18 self.assertIn(CursorKind.TRANSLATION_UNIT, kinds)
19 self.assertIn(CursorKind.VARIABLE_REF, kinds)
20 self.assertIn(CursorKind.LAMBDA_EXPR, kinds)
21 self.assertIn(CursorKind.OBJ_BOOL_LITERAL_EXPR, kinds)
22 self.assertIn(CursorKind.OBJ_SELF_EXPR, kinds)
23 self.assertIn(CursorKind
[all...]
H A Dtest_cursor.py11 from clang.cindex import CursorKind namespace
68 self.assertEqual(tu_nodes[0].kind, CursorKind.STRUCT_DECL)
79 self.assertEqual(s0_nodes[0].kind, CursorKind.FIELD_DECL)
82 self.assertEqual(s0_nodes[1].kind, CursorKind.FIELD_DECL)
86 self.assertEqual(tu_nodes[1].kind, CursorKind.STRUCT_DECL)
91 self.assertEqual(tu_nodes[2].kind, CursorKind.FUNCTION_DECL)
148 self.assertEqual(xs[0].kind, CursorKind.CLASS_DECL)
150 self.assertEqual(cs[0].kind, CursorKind.CONSTRUCTOR)
151 self.assertEqual(cs[1].kind, CursorKind.CONSTRUCTOR)
152 self.assertEqual(cs[2].kind, CursorKind
[all...]
H A Dtest_exception_specification_kind.py14 if node.kind == clang.cindex.CursorKind.FUNCTION_DECL:
H A Dtest_tokens.py6 from clang.cindex import CursorKind namespace
29 self.assertEqual(cursor.kind, CursorKind.VAR_DECL)
H A Dtest_type.py9 from clang.cindex import CursorKind namespace
49 self.assertEqual(fields[0].kind, CursorKind.FIELD_DECL)
57 self.assertEqual(fields[1].kind, CursorKind.FIELD_DECL)
66 self.assertEqual(fields[2].kind, CursorKind.FIELD_DECL)
74 self.assertEqual(fields[3].kind, CursorKind.FIELD_DECL)
82 self.assertEqual(fields[4].kind, CursorKind.FIELD_DECL)
90 self.assertEqual(fields[5].kind, CursorKind.FIELD_DECL)
98 self.assertEqual(fields[6].kind, CursorKind.FIELD_DECL)
106 self.assertEqual(fields[7].kind, CursorKind.FIELD_DECL)
414 self.assertEqual(children[0].kind, CursorKind
[all...]
H A Dtest_translation_unit.py13 from clang.cindex import CursorKind namespace
64 self.assertIs(c.kind, CursorKind.TRANSLATION_UNIT)
155 inclusion_directive_files = [c.get_included_file().name for c in tu.cursor.get_children() if c.kind == CursorKind.INCLUSION_DIRECTIVE]
/netbsd-current/external/apache2/llvm/dist/clang/bindings/python/clang/
H A Dcindex.py657 class CursorKind(BaseEnumeration): class in inherits:BaseEnumeration
659 A CursorKind describes the kind of entity that a cursor points to.
668 """Return all CursorKind enumeration instances."""
669 return [x for x in CursorKind._kinds if not x is None]
708 return 'CursorKind.%s' % (self.name,)
719 CursorKind.UNEXPOSED_DECL = CursorKind(1)
722 CursorKind.STRUCT_DECL = CursorKind(2)
725 CursorKind
[all...]
/netbsd-current/external/apache2/llvm/dist/clang/include/clang/Sema/
H A DCodeCompleteConsumer.h791 CXCursorKind CursorKind;
881 CursorKind(CXCursor_NotImplemented), Hidden(false), InBaseClass(false),
890 CursorKind(CXCursor_MacroDefinition), Hidden(false), InBaseClass(false),
898 CXCursorKind CursorKind = CXCursor_NotImplemented,
902 CursorKind(CursorKind), Availability(Availability), Hidden(false),
/netbsd-current/external/apache2/llvm/dist/clang/lib/Sema/
H A DCodeCompleteConsumer.cpp698 CursorKind = getCursorKindForDecl(Declaration);
699 if (CursorKind == CXCursor_UnexposedDecl) {
704 CursorKind = CXCursor_ObjCInterfaceDecl;
706 CursorKind = CXCursor_ObjCProtocolDecl;
708 CursorKind = CXCursor_NotImplemented;
H A DSemaCodeComplete.cpp1074 R.CursorKind = getCursorKindForDecl(R.Declaration);
6311 CCR.CursorKind = CXCursor_MemberRef;
6331 CCR.CursorKind = getCursorKindForDecl(Ctor);
/netbsd-current/external/apache2/llvm/dist/clang/tools/libclang/
H A DCIndexCodeCompletion.cpp588 R.CursorKind = Results[I].CursorKind;
667 R.CursorKind = CXCursor_OverloadCandidate;
/netbsd-current/external/apache2/llvm/dist/clang/lib/Frontend/
H A DASTUnit.cpp397 CachedResult.Kind = R.CursorKind;
493 CachedResult.Kind = R.CursorKind;
/netbsd-current/external/apache2/llvm/dist/clang/include/clang-c/
H A DIndex.h5160 enum CXCursorKind CursorKind; member in struct:__anon218
/netbsd-current/external/apache2/llvm/dist/clang/tools/c-index-test/
H A Dc-index-test.c2508 CXString ks = clang_getCursorKindSpelling(completion_result->CursorKind);
4838 " c-index-test -print-usr [<CursorKind> {<args>}]*\n"

Completed in 176 milliseconds